ECC announces Academic All-Region honors

The Ellsworth Community College athletic department has been informed by the Iowa Community College Athletic Conference (ICCAC) that 62 ECC student-athletes qualified for Fall Academic All-Region honors. First Team honorees must have a grade point average (GPA) of 3.5 to 4.0, and Second Team honorees must have a 3.0 to 3.49 GPA.

"We are extremely proud of our student athletes for being recognized for their work in the classroom," commented ECC Athletic Director Nate Forsyth.
